MaryClare Brzytwa

• composer • performer (flute, laptop, electronics)

MaryClare Brzytwa is a flutist, composer, aspiring rock star and ex catholic-school girl. She hails from the outskirts of Cleveland, Ohio and now lives in Oakland, California. where she teaches Do-Re-Mi to dozens of future piano monsters right out of her home. MaryClare’s music takes listeners through noise, salsa, improvisation, microtonality, rock guitar licks, and laptop manipulations. She is the queen of B-bands: Bolivar Zoar, Byznich, and Bebe Donkey, which span out-kitchfolk, electronic minimalism, and pseudo Christianic loungecore. She is 1/3 of the legendary all female free improvisation outfit: Slow, Children and has toured internationally in clubs, music festivals, flute gatherings, and academic institutions. In 2006, MaryClare earned her BA in Composition / Electronic Media from Mills College and has studied and/or collaborated with Robert Dick, Maggi Payne, Fred Frith, Angela Korogolos, Michiko Kawagoe, William Winant, Mochipet, Antoine Berthaiume, Joelle Leandre, and more. MaryClare likes expensive couscous, and her therapist, Susan. 0207
